National Institute of Technology Goa is a public/government college which was established in 2010. National Institute of Technology Goa is ranked 90 by NIRF (National Institutional Ranking Framework) for BTech. Being a public/government college, the fee is not very high but even if the students find the fee a little high, they can apply for the scholarships offered by the National Institute of Technology Goa.

Indian Institute of Information Technology Surat is an institute of national importance established by the Ministry of Human Resource Development (MHRD), Government of India. It is a non-profit and public-private partnership institute under the Act of Parliament 2017. IIIT Surat offers Undergraduate and doctoral degrees in Information Technology field. According to the IIIT Surat placement statistics 2023, the highest package and average package offered to BTech CSEand ECE were INR 24.19 LPA and INR 24 LPA, respectively. Being a Public-private institute, the college offers various facilities to students to students.
